Text

By July 1, 2018, the Bureau of Cannabis Control, in coordination with the Department of General Services, shall establish an office to collect fees and taxes in the County of Humboldt, County of Trinity, or County of Mendocino in order to ensure the safe payment and collection of cash in those counties.

Legislative History

Amended by Stats. 2021, Ch. 70, Sec. 88. (AB 141) Effective July 12, 2021.
